Home Invasion in Paphos: Two Women Robbed at Gunpoint, Police Investigate

Two Ukrainian women visiting Cyprus suffered a home invasion and armed robbery early afternoon yesterday at their Paphos holiday accommodation, as reported by police this morning.

Details of the Incident

According to the local CID, the incident took place around two in the afternoon when two men broke into their apartment, threatened them with pistols, and stole almost two thousand euros in cash. The victims, aged 24 and 30, were left shaken but unharmed. The perpetrators managed to escape on foot, taking with them 1600 euros from the 24-year-old woman.

The police have issued arrest warrants against the two men, based on the descriptions provided by the victims. The Paphos CID is actively investigating the case, focusing on armed robbery and illegal possession of firearms.
